Model-related data (basic design)
Number of cylinders 12 16
Operating method: four-stroke cycle, diesel, single-action X X
Combustion method: direct fuel injection X X
Number of cylinders 12 16
Cylinder arrangement: Vee angle Degrees
(°)
90 90
Bore mm 135 135
Stroke mm 156 156
Displacement of a cylinder Liters 2.233 2.233
Total displacement Liters 26.8 35.7
Compression ratio 17.5 17.5
Standard housing connecting flange (engine main PTO side) SAE 0 0
Table 52: Model-related data (basic design)
